On 2016-11-23 12:27, Larry Rosenman wrote: > trying to installworld on a box I just recompiled from 10.3 to 11.0, > and am running the 11.0-STABLE kernel. > > I get: > ===> lib/libbsdstat (install) > install -C -o root -g wheel -m 444 libprivatebsdstat.a /usr/lib/ > install -C -o root -g wheel -m 444 libprivatebsdstat_p.a /usr/lib/ > install -s -o root -g wheel -m 444 libprivatebsdstat.so.1 > /usr/lib/ > strip: open /usr/lib//libprivatebsdstat.so.1 failed: No such file or > directory > install: strip command strip failed on /usr/lib//libprivatebsdstat.so.1 > *** Error code 70 [snip] Something(tm) went wonky(tm) with the bootfs. I created a new bootfs, and was able to installworld to it, and boot off of it.
